A Motor boat’s speed in still water is 18 km/h. What will be the downstream speed of the motorboat, when the river is flowing at a speed of 12 km/h.1. 15 km / h2. 25 km / h3. 30 km / h4. 35 km / h5. 40 km / h

Answer» Correct Answer - Option 3 : 30 km / h

Given:

Speed of Motorboat in still water (x) = 18 km/h

Speed of River (y) = 12 km/h

Formula Used:

Speed Downstream = (x + y)

Calculations:

Speed of motorboat in still water (x) = 18 km/h

Speed of River (y) = 12 km/h

∴ Downstream Speed of the motorboat = (x + y)

⇒ 18 + 12

⇒ 30 km/h

The downstream speed of the motorboat is 30 km/h.
